Treated Fence Installation in Pearland, TX
Treated fence installation services involve the placement of fences that have been specially treated to resist rot, pests, and weather damage, making them suitable for long-lasting outdoor boundaries. These projects typically include installing fences around residential properties for privacy, security, or aesthetic purposes, such as backyard enclosures, garden borders, or perimeter fences. Property owners often want to understand the types of treated materials available, the durability of different fencing options, and how the installation process can enhance the property's value and appearance.
Before requesting treated fence installation, homeowners should consider the specific purpose of the fence, the desired material, and the overall style that complements their property. It’s also helpful to determine the preferred height, gate placements, and any local regulations or homeowner association guidelines that may influence the project. Understanding these factors can ensure the fence me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ences, resulting in a durable and attractive addition to the property.

Treated Fence Installation Questions
What are the benefits of treated fence installation? Treated fences offer increased durability and resistance to pests, helping them last longer in the outdoor environment.
What types of fencing projects are common in Pearland? Homeowners often request treated fences for privacy, property boundaries, and decorative purposes around residential yards.
How does treated wood compare to untreated options? Treated wood is more resistant to moisture, decay, and insect damage, making it a practical choice for outdoor fencing.
What should property owners consider before installing a treated fence? It's important to evaluate the fence's purpose, desired style, and local building codes to ensure the right fit for the property.
